A rain interruption lasting 1 hour and 13 minutes occurred on Saturday, affecting the scheduled start time. Originally slated to begin at 1:03 p.m., this timing had initially seemed adequate to avoid any overlap with a 7 p.m. concert taking place at the neighboring M&T Bank Stadium, featuring renowned artists Billy Joel and Stevie Nicks. However, the adverse weather conditions may jeopardize the timely progression of the game. As the Orioles’ first home playoff encounter since 2014 unfolded, the temperature stood at 63 degrees Fahrenheit beneath a clear, blue sky. Kyle Bradish took the mound to deliver the game’s inaugural pitch. Additionally, former Baltimore star Adam Jones had the honor of throwing the ceremonial first pitch, while the national anthem was performed by longtime Orioles enthusiast Joan Jett.
